Understanding the Utility and Application of Hex Socket Self-Tapping Screws Hex socket self-tapping screws, an essential tool in various industries, have become a ubiquitous fastening solution due to their versatility and efficiency. These screws, as the name suggests, feature a hexagonal socket in the head, designed specifically for use with a hex wrench or socket driver, providing superior torque transmission and minimizing slippage during installation. Self-tapping screws, unlike ordinary screws, create their own thread in the material they're being inserted into, eliminating the need for a pre-threaded hole. This characteristic makes them ideal for use in materials like metal, wood, or plastic where threading is not already present or when a stronger hold is required. The hex socket design adds an extra layer of functionality, enabling easier and more precise tightening, especially in tight spaces. The hexagonal socket head offers several advantages over conventional screwdrivers. It allows for better control and reduces the chances of cam-out, which is the premature detachment of the driver from the screw during high-torque applications. Additionally, the hex socket design enables the use of power tools, significantly speeding up the process and reducing manual labor. One key application of hex socket self-tapping screws is in automotive engineering. They are commonly used for securing panels, mounting accessories, and assembling various components due to their strength and ease of installation. Moreover, in the electronics industry, hex socket self-tapping screws are often utilized for securing circuit boards and other components in place. Their ability to tap their own threads in lightweight materials like aluminum or plastic makes them perfect for this purpose. In machinery and equipment manufacturing, these screws provide robust fixing solutions, ensuring that parts remain securely fastened even under heavy loads or dynamic conditions. Their resistance to vibration and shear forces makes them a reliable choice in industrial settings. In conclusion, hex socket self-tapping screws are a testament to the ingenuity of engineering.
